[QUOTE="zip1, post: 765439, member: 16018"] [b]A while back I did[/b] So there's five disks per side, three flat and two wavy (thick & thin), I took the thin wavy and replaced it with another thick. Unfortunately I had to buy two sets of disks to do this but, when I pulled it out to sell there was very minimal slippage at all. I ran this in a dana30 front axle, my steering went to heck, five point turns vs three, especially down at Rimrock. Replacing the wavy washer also seemed to put the case at it's limits in putting it back together. It worked great for me, other than the turning it hooked up well. Getting a detroit was a huge difference though [/QUOTE]
